Coronavirus, Education

The Hon. T.A. FRANKS (14:25): Supplementary: did not the AHPPC recommend 1.5-metre social distancing for schools?

The Hon. S.G. WADE (Minister for Health and Wellbeing) (14:25): The AHPPC has clarified its advice and they—

The Hon. T.A. Franks: Changed its advice.

The Hon. S.G. WADE: No, with all due respect—sorry, I shouldn't let her be disorderly and interject—

The PRESIDENT: It's out of order so continue, minister, please.

The Hon. S.G. WADE: The AHPPC advice is consistently being followed by the South Australian government, including in terms of the conduct of teaching within the school precincts.
